Default Car Costs

Hi,

Can anybody please tell me the cost of running a 2nd hand car in Alberta.

Obviously the price and gas aside, just the mandatory yearly fees.

Registration costs? Can insurance be paid monthly? MOT? Thanks in advance

OP does say Alberta.

DD driving for just over a year pays $1200 in insurance, (2003 chev malibu) car tax cost s i think about $90 pa, but more the 1st time as you have to buy the plate, no mot, sometimes insurance will ask for an inspection on an older car, insurance can be paid in instalments for an extra charge. Be aware that second hand cars will be more expensive here than in the uk. Search vehicle registries for more info.

My first registration for my truck was $170 and my bike was $130, the renewals came through last week and they're $85 and $65 respectively...the registration renews based on your surname initial, so if you register a car half way through the year, the price is pro-rated to when your renewal would be.

new windscreen every year will run you about $150 Decline windscreen insurance, it's just not worth it

switching tires between winter and summer (if you're into that sort of thing) will probably cost about $40-50 if you have mounted tires, more if you have loose tires. Obviously not including the cost of the tires themselves

A lot of cities have by-laws preventing you from washing your car with soap in the street/your drive so the soapy water doesn't go down the drains...so depending on your preference, factor in $10/month for car washes. I pop to the jet wash and do the windows, mirrors, lights and plate every 10 days or so in the winter

Using your block heater in the winter does use a fair amount of electricity, so get it set on a timer rather than just having it on all night and wasting money...it only needs a couple of hours before you start the engine.
